Navin Chohan

It’s ok. Basically a typical park slope bar. Biggest problem was that the services was mediocre to the extreme. Bar staff just stood around talking to each other for 5 minutes before even deigning to acknowledge me. The bar was not busy. Food service (literally just a portion of 6 buffalo wings) took 30 mins to turn up. In the meantime I saw the kitchen get another group of three’s food order wrong.
Scrapes a 3 star score since the atmosphere is ok and their beer selection has a couple of decent German offerings on draught. Otherwise Prospect Bar & Grill is not worth going out of your way for.
